Star and City has two play modes, one for in conflict and another for other times, and merges mechanics from TTRPGs like Blades in the Dark and Tenra Bansho Zero with inspiration from computer games like Dicey Dungeons.

Free to Download: SCP The Tabletop RPG Quickstart
The download dives straight into the rules, explaining attribute checks, exploding dice, the rule of one and versus rolls. Questions like “which dice do I use?” aren’t answered, so SCP RPG’s quickstart might be better suited to gamers with some experience.
